Truck
Salesman Saves the Show
As
reported in the Derbyshire Times recently,
Keltruck Account Manager Matt
Bird has saved the show!
Matt
stepped into the breach when the performer originally
cast for the role of Lun Tha in 'The King and I'
had to pull out due to family commitments leaving just
a month to learn his lines for the character.
"I
thought I'd give it a go even though I didn't know the
show or anyone in the company. It will be the first
time I've performed at the Pomegranate," said
Matt (37) who lives in Morton.
Matt,
pictured left in a different role, is no stranger to
the stage. He has trod the boards with Ripley &
Alfreton Operatic Society playing Curly in 'Oklanhoma'
& Lancelot in 'Camelot', & with Belper
Operatic Society playing Mr Snow in 'Carousel'.
'The
King and I' is at the Pomegranate Theatre,
Chesterfield from Wednesday 28 to Saturday 31 May.
Performances start at 19:30 with a Saturday matinee at
14:30. Evening tickets cost £10 & the matinee
tickets are £8. To book call 01246 345222.

From
'Uttoxeter' With Love
Following their success in winning
their league in the Scania More For Your Money 3, the parts department
staff at Keltruck Burton were treated to a day out by Scania
(Great Britain) Ltd.
Staff chose a James Bond themed night at Uttoxeter
racecourse & were accompanied by their partners in an
evening's racing which was enjoyed by all.
Roulette tables
& blackjack were on offer, along with a full card of
horse racing. Winners & losers were picked, with several tips supplied from Regional
General Manager Geoff Hodgkiss, who was on hand throughout the event.
The
parts department would like to thank all those involved in this great day out
& look forward to more success in future campaigns.
Neil
Vazey & Bob Venables
Andrew Jamieson, Aftersales Director, has announced that on 1 June 2008 Neil Vazey will take over at Keltruck West Bromwich whilst Bob Venables will be moving over to Keltruck Willenhall. Russell Warner remains Regional General Manager for both depots.
This mini reorganisation sees Neil,
35, moving back to the depot where he first started as an apprentice in
1991. Since then Neil has risen through the ranks to now managing the £5m turnover operation at West Bromwich,
the biggest depot in the Keltruck network. Neil is joined by Russ Warner, Regional General Manager covering the company's aftersales operations in the Black Country area, who also started as a apprentice at the West Bromwich depot in 1987, along with Andrew Jamieson, Aftersales Director, and Chris Kelly, Chairman & Managing Director, both of whom started as apprentices in the industry.
Chris
Kelly said: "I am delighted with Neil's appointment. Having seen Neil develop from boy to man & from apprentice to senior manager I feel a sense of pride in the investment Keltruck has made in its people over the past 25 years. We look forward to many more similar success stories over the next 25 years!"
Andrew Jamieson added: "The West Bromwich depot was opened in 1983 as the company's first location. It has grown considerably since that time with a workshop extension & a paintshop connected to the accident repair centre opening in the last 18 months alone. Today Keltruck West Bromwich is the largest operation of its type in the UK offering a one-stop shop for transport operators from the truck, bus & coach sectors. Bob Venables will be taking on the Willenhall depot which continues to grow, going from strength to strength since opening back in January 2006. We wish both Neil & Bob all the best in their new roles.
